命令行界面工具:cmd 和powerShell的區(qū)別
Cmd(Command Prompt)和 PowerShell 都是命令行界面工具,用于在 Windows 操作系統(tǒng)中執(zhí)行命令和本。

在 Windows 中打開 Cmd 和 PowerShell的方式:
打開 Cmd:
按下 Win + R 組合鍵,打開運(yùn)行對(duì)話框。
輸入 "cmd",然后按下 Enter 鍵。
這將打開一個(gè)新的命令提示符窗口。
打開 PowerShell:
按下 Win + R 組合鍵,打開運(yùn)行對(duì)話框。
輸入 "powershell",然后按下 Enter 鍵。
這將打開一個(gè)新的 PowerShell 窗口。
另外,也可以通過以下方式在 Windows 中找到 Cmd 和 PowerShell 的快捷方式,并單擊打開它們:
Cmd 快捷方式:在開始菜單或任務(wù)欄中搜索 "命令提示符",然后單擊打開。
PowerShell 快捷方式:在開始菜單或任務(wù)欄中搜索 "PowerShell",然后單擊打開。

它們之間有以下幾個(gè)區(qū)別:
功能和語(yǔ)法:PowerShell一種更強(qiáng)大和活的命令行具,它基于.NET Framework,并支持更復(fù)雜的腳本編寫和執(zhí)行。PowerShell 提供了一整套強(qiáng)大的命令和功能,可以進(jìn)行更高級(jí)的管理和自動(dòng)化操作。相比之下,Cmd 的功能相對(duì)簡(jiǎn)單,主要用于基本的命令執(zhí)行。
命令和別名:PowerShell 提供了許多強(qiáng)大的命令和功能,這些命令通常使用動(dòng)詞-名詞的形式命名,例如
Get-Process
、Set-ExecutionPolicy
。此外,PowerShell 還支持別名,可以使用短名稱來執(zhí)行某些常用的命令。Cmd 的命令相對(duì)較少,并且沒有別名的概念。腳本語(yǔ)言:PowerShell 是一種完整的腳本語(yǔ)言,具有條件、循環(huán)、函數(shù)、異常處理等常見編程語(yǔ)言的特性。這使得 PowerShell 更適合編寫復(fù)雜的腳本和自動(dòng)化任務(wù)。Cmd 也可以編寫簡(jiǎn)單的批處理腳本,但其功能有限,語(yǔ)法較為簡(jiǎn)單。
兼容性:Cmd 是 Windows 操作系統(tǒng)的默認(rèn)命令行工具,幾乎在所有版本的 Windows 中都可用。PowerShell 起初是作為附加組件提供的,但從 Windows 7 開始成為默認(rèn)的命令行工具,并在后續(xù)版本中得到了更多的改進(jìn)和增強(qiáng)。
總的來說,PowerShell 是一個(gè)更強(qiáng)大和靈活的命令行工具,適合進(jìn)行高級(jí)的管理和自動(dòng)化操作。而 Cmd 則更適合進(jìn)行基本的命令執(zhí)行。您可以根據(jù)自己的需求選擇使用其中之一。